Barrhaven to get second hotel

Jon Willing
Postmedia
December 7, 2018


Jan Harder is excited her Barrhaven ward is becoming a hotel hotbed.

The Hampton Inn would open around the same time a Marriott hotel is scheduled to open in the suburb. The Barrhaven BIA lists both projects on its website, saying the each will have 100 rooms.

The Marriott hotel’s development application is for 4433 Strandherd Dr.

Hotel operators continue to look for opportunities outside of Ottawa’s core, including Orléans, Bells Corners and Kanata.
